Tigers | Adam Wilk suffers loss Saturday
Detroit Tigers SP Adam Wilk (shoulder) allowed two runs on three hits over five innings in a loss to the Chicago White Sox Saturday, April 14, with one walk and four strikeouts. He was tagged with the loss, falling to 0-1 on the year. Wilk left the game with a bruised left shoulder after he was hit by a foul ball off the bat of 1B Prince Fielder while sitting in the dugout but is expected to make his next start.
